Capistrano and Tevare offer unique floor plans in popular Paseos Village

The gated neighborhoods of Capistrano by CalAtlantic Homes and Tevare by KB Home have more in common than just an elevated Paseos Village location in the master-planned community of Summerlin. Homes in the two neighborhoods offer some of the best views and feature some of the most distinctive floor plans currently selling in Summerlin. And they are both within close proximity of two new schools, two village parks and Summerlin’s award-winning trail system.

Located along the foothills of Red Rock Canyon National Conservation Area, Capistrano offers four two-story floor plans ranging from 2,227 to 3,020 square feet. They feature an optional and spacious front courtyard pool, hidden rooftop decks and large accordion-style sliding glass doors that turn great rooms into breezeways, seamlessly connecting front and backyards. Options include a casita, deck, super loggia and built-in rooftop-deck fireplace. These unique home designs are enhanced by energy-saving building elements. Capistrano homes are priced from the mid-$400,000s.

One exceptionally special Capistrano floor plan, the Cabrillo, features an inverted home design with an elevated main entrance that opens to a landing that has a short staircase leading to the main living level that includes great room, kitchen, dining room, den and grand master suite. Stairs leading down from the entry landing reveal additional bedrooms, a large family room and den.

The Tevare neighborhood offers five floor plans, including one single-level home. They range from 1,849 to 2,625 square feet and include three to five bedrooms. Tevare homes offer hundreds of design options, including gourmet kitchens with large breakfast bars, granite kitchen countertops and birch or maple wood cabinets. Tevare homes are priced from the mid-$300,000s.

Tevare also features multiple home-intelligence upgrades using Z-Wave brand technology. This includes a touch screen keypad to monitor windows and doors, motion sensor, automated push-button and keyless door locks and glass-break sensors. The system also includes a wireless two-way doorbell video phone with camera connected to the front door/door bell and home intercom. Tevare homes also offer energy-efficient technologies, including electrical vehicle-charging stations in the garage.
